Baltimore Ravens at Pittsburgh Steelers
The Steelers (10-0) host the Ravens (6-4). Pittsburgh rallied to beat Baltimore 28-24 in Week 8 behind two TD passes from Ben Roethlisberger. The Steelers lead the NFL in sacks (38) and turnover differential (plus-12) in 2020.

Pittsburgh Steelers at Buffalo Bills
The Bills host the Steelers. Buffalo halted a six-game series slide with a 17-10 victory in 2019. The Bills' Josh Allen threw a TD pass and rushed for another in that game. The Steelers' Ben Roethlisberger did not play because of an elbow injury.

Cleveland Browns at New York Giants
The Browns (9-4) visit the Giants (5-8). Cleveland saw its four-game winning streak come to an end in Week 14, falling to Baltimore for the second time in 2020, 47-42. New York also had a four-game streak snapped when it was upended 26-7 by Arizona.

Tennessee Titans at Green Bay Packers
High-powered collide on Sunday Night Football as the Packers (11-3) host the Titans (10-4). Tennessee led the NFL in points with 436 entering Week 16 while Green Bay paced the NFC with 434. The Packers' Aaron Rodgers had a league-best 40 TD passes.

Washington Football Team at Philadelphia Eagles
Washington (6-9) can win the NFC East with a victory over Philadelphia (4-10-1). Washington missed an opportunity to wrap up its first division title since 2015 by losing to Carolina 20-13 last week. Washington defeated Philadelphia 27-17 in Week 1.
